Puppy day care is more than just a playdate. For a young dog, it’s a structured environment to learn crucial skills. They practice polite play with other dogs of various sizes and temperaments, building confidence under professional supervision. This is especially valuable before hitting the busy trails of the Victory Basin Wildlife Management Area or encountering other dogs on the Glover Town Green. A good day care helps curb those puppy behaviors like excessive barking or nipping by providing positive outlets for their energy and curiosity.
So, how do you choose the right spot for your West Glover pup? Look beyond the brochure. Schedule a visit and trust your nose—the facility should be clean and odor-controlled. Ask about their intake process: a reputable center will require proof of vaccinations and conduct a temperament evaluation to ensure safe group play. Inquire about the daily schedule. Is there a balance of active play, training moments, and enforced nap times? Puppies need rest just as much as romping!

Before the first day, prepare your puppy. Practice short separations at home. Bring a familiar blanket or toy from home that smells like you—it’s a little comfort from the Kingdom. And most importantly, communicate openly with the staff. Tell them if your pup is wary of loud trucks (we all know logging season!) or is working on not chasing the chickens.
